Duet bed mesh. I bet you will figure it out lol.
Duet bed mesh 8 on Mon Apr 06 2020 18:55:28 GMT+0100 (British Summer Time) M561 ; clear any bed transform ;G29 ; probe the bed and enable compensation ;G28 ; home G1 Y310 F7000 ; Pick Up Klicky G1 X42 F7000 ; Pick Up Klicky G1 Y358 F7000 Apr 29, 2019 · For Mesh Bed Compensation, is there a suggested or acceptable level of deviation (max to min) to ensure Mesh Bed Compensation is working as intended? Just curious as to what the Duet Wifi can handle from a max/min deviation perspective. Like Mesh Bed Compensation (MBC), it probes the bed but the result is information on how much to turn each adjustment screw to level the bed. g. com Jul 9, 2020 · @Tryptamine said in Mesh Bed Compensation NOT compensating enough:. The machine goes back to the first point calibration for no Oct 22, 2018 · Define your mesh bed leveling grid with the M557 command. G32 just calls bed. 26 Mesh bed compensation allows the printer to adjust the nozzle height during printing to compensate for an uneven bed or for sag in the gantry. May 15, 2023 · The adaptive mesh part is the one that's most "involved" in regard to other parts of my config since it checks if the bed is trammed or not etc. ABL is when you have multiple lead screw motors and the Duet adjusts them to make your bed level. I use an inductive probe (temperature stable SuperPinda) for homing and quad gantry levelling (qgl) of my Voron 2. 1 running on Duet WiFi 1. In general, machines use the same method to scan the bed as to probe the bed to set the Z height, for example using a switch, nozzle contact probe, BL touch, or other z probe to measure the Z May 8, 2017 · run G32 with a bed. On Duet 3 boards, you can connect a probe to any IO connector. 02 or later + DueX5. 009, points used 4, deviation before 0. 4. Performed a high resolution map (21 x 21) at temperature. May 3, 2021 · It's best to get your bed as physically level as possible; G29 mesh compensation is to compensate for anomalies in the bed surface, not for a skewed bed (though it can). Oct 6, 2022 · Hello, I have an issue with my mesh bed compensation. This will help allow you to move down lower with baby stepping, but the mesh compensation should be able to adjust to follow the bed regardless because it's not going down below 0, it's adjusting to keep 0 at the surface of the bed. 005 0. 004 -0. Apr 24, 2018 · You're in luck, as I recently finished implementing mesh bed compensation with a BLTouch on my Dbot. May 5, 2022 · I picked a common point on one corner for my z-axis datum, my probe z offset, my bed tilt probing points, and my bed mesh compensation. csv" and DOES NOT seem to enable mesh leveling. Level your bed; One of the main advantages of the Horizon is being able to do a mesh leveling of your bed using the tip of your nozzle as a probe before every print. The result of running mesh compensation can be seen in the Height Map screen (see below) in the main menu. Config Files are modified versions of config supplied by E3D. g; Configuration file for Duet WiFi / Ethernet level the nozzle to the bed and set actual Z (G92 Z0) Work out the actual Z offset needed for the probe (G1 Z10,G30 S-1) x 5 work out the average offset and then set the offset in config. It normally takes several iterations to get the bed truly level. g ; called to perform automatic bed compensation via G32 ; ; generated by RepRapFirmware Configuration Tool v2. ¶ Duet Z probe pins. G29 probing uses a grid of points. g Mar 11, 2025 · Follow the "Firmware configuration" part of this guide for the configuration of the Horizon using Marlin or Duet (more firmware guides will be added in the future). This will move the head to nine points and let's me adjust Z-height via a menu in definable increments (currently set to 0. 006 after 0. 3 (2021-06-15) Duet WiFi Server Version: 1. The Duet can take just over 400 mesh bed data points and in my case it takes about 3 hours to run a full (automated) scan. The compensation shown is consistent across all tools. g Oct 27, 2018 · After the mesh leveling was done, I then ran an auto bed leveling again and got below: 3:02:20 PMLeadscrew adjustments made: 0. The config. You can connect a Z probe directly to your Duet. 000 Jan 1, 2021 · M122 gives RepRapFirmware for Duet 2 WiFi/Ethernet version 2. You can use this in a number of ways; if you have multiple independent leadscrews (2, 3 or 4), they can level the bed plane: https://duet3d. 1. You can change the maximum and minimum values of the mesh as well as the interval but be careful as running G29 with a wrong mesh can crash your printer. You run G29 S0 (or just G29) to probe Jul 20, 2020 · @Pierrelito said in Manual bed probing / Mesh bed compensation Issue [DUET3]: When moving the Z axis to make the nozzle touch the bed, the machine often randomly goes back to the starting height (dive height) of the point. Mesh Bed Compensation (MBC) is intended to compensate for irregularities in the surface of the bed. Mesh bed compensation (MBC) allows the printer adjust the nozzle height during printing to compensate for an uneven bed or for sag in the gantry. It would be a real bummer if I had to do that before every print Jun 5, 2017 · After this process is finished, I heat up both bed and hotend to regular operating temperature and start fine-leveling by initiating Marlin's Mesh Bed Leveling. Jan 20, 2020 · No, once a bed mesh has been built, it is loaded automatically (if so enabled in config. Some probes may need specific capabilities e. Also i haven't gotten around to writing a readme for the adaptive probing/mesh, so that's also something you would have to figure out on your own until i get it sorted Jun 20, 2021 · As noted above, the bed itself is definitely the main source of the funky height map, my new bed is much better (tested by literally placing the new bed plate on top of the existing bed and probing that), but it will be a while until I can actually use that. I have a Duet 2 wifi and a Core XY printer with 3 Z axis bed leveling (3 belt driven Z axis and the bed is on a kinematic coupling system). Let's start with a description of the printer: It's a Cartesian with a fixed print bed and 4 ball screws, with as many motors, regarding the Z axis. Bed compensation in use: mesh, comp offset 0. Normally you do this in config. See Mode 0 below. Mesh bed compensation allows the printer to adjust the nozzle height during printing to compensate for an uneven bed or for sag in the gantry. Mesh bed compensation (MBC) allows the printer adjust the nozzle height during printing to compensate for an uneven bed or for sag in the gantry. I'll share my config set with you and try and answer your questions. G29 probing uses a grid of points defined by its size and the spacing between points. dozuki. You run G29 S0 (or just G29) to probe Once set up correctly Mesh bed compensation probes the bed in a number of points and then uses that mesh to compensate for uneven bed surfaces. . g containing a M557 command; In my case if I run G32 , the probe deploy correctly and mesh levellingwill be completed without errors , while If I run G29 the probe miss the deploy even if the deploy command is present in the bed. Nov 6, 2023 · It is distinct from Bed Levelling, as it assumes the bed is as level as the user or other processes can get it, before a mesh of the bed surface is built. Where the Duet read the mesh levelling info while running G29 command? Other question. It allows for a point mesh of the bed to be built up quickly as no movement in Z is required to read the bed distance, and individual readings happen very quickly. g routine. Modified my macros so that for every print it will do the following: Sep 5, 2019 · "Auto Bed Compensation" runs the g-code in bed. g file should already have configured a working mesh: M557 X50:370 Y10:350 S30. M557 defines the size and spacing between points. But the worst happens at points different than the first one. 000. 02mm) until I am satisfied with the bed-nozzle-distance of The Duet 3 Scanning Z probe is a CAN-FD connected inductive sensing board, with compatible inductive PCB coils. g, saves to "heightmap. Oct 27, 2018 · After the mesh leveling was done, I then ran an auto bed leveling again and got below: 3:02:20 PMLeadscrew adjustments made: 0. g) on startup and is used as a default for every print. Board: Duet 2 WiFi (2WiFi) Firmware: RepRapFirmware for Duet 2 WiFi/Ethernet 3. I bet you will figure it out lol. 05. 0:/sys/config. Z-Minimum to a negative value. Sep 15, 2019 · [Edit: The only thing I have spotted that I don't do is cancel previous mesh bed levelling before I set the Z=0 and offset procedures, cant see that being relevant as the G92 z0 when the nozzle is on the bed sets the golden reference point ] Sep 3, 2022 · ; bed. Mesh bed compensation works like this: On power up no mesh bed compensation is in use; You define a grid using the M557 command. "Mesh Grid Compensation" runs G29 and then explicitly enables it by running G29 S1 Dec 5, 2021 · I have a problem with Mesh Bed Compensation and I can't find a solution. OK, then sorting out the bed should sort out most of the issue. It would be a real bummer if I had to do that before every print Dec 29, 2020 · Hello, I'm struggeling with the mesh bed levelling in RRF3. 000 After performing a Mesh Bed leveling, when powering off and then starting up again will the 3D printer automatically read the file that was saved? Is there any needed process/procedure that needs to run the next time the machine is started or just home it and go? ampapa, Mesh bed compensation; If you don't have a Z probe, you can still use mesh bed compensation and other features normally associated with a Z probe. Auto bed leveling and mesh bed compensation are different. 006 -0. lcjd guv bzbxy qjta maxli jxmpo xwdo vuro yvkiy rqydzipv hqwqnyv keti vklbi fqhljp cldz